Contact SupplierKyowa Interface, Japan have been manufacturing contact angle meters since 1960.The contact angle meter also goes by the name goniometer. These instruments are used in contact angle measurement, surface free energy analysis, and surface or interfacial tension measurement.
DMe-211 are economical yet fully-featured contact angle meters with computer image analysis system "FAMAS" software enables automatic analysis of contact angle. The upper grade model DMe-211 enables measurements of surface/interfacial tension by pendant drop method as well.
Analysis of surface free energy is possible with optional add-in software.

Specifications:
Model: DMe-211
Measuring Method: Sessile drop, Pendant drop (by computer image analysis system)
Analysis method:
(i) Contact angle: θ/2 method, Tangent method
(ii) Surface/Interfacial tension: ds/de method
Measuring range:
(i) Contact angle: 0 - 180°
(ii)Surface/Interfacial tension: 0 - 100 mN/m
Display resolution:
Contact angle: 0.1°
Surface/Interfacial tension: 0.1mN/m
Accuracy:
Contact angle: 0.3°
Surface/Interfacial tension: 0.3mN/m (Repeatability described in standard deviation)
Field of view:
Fixed focus: 6.3 mm (W) x 4.7mm (H)
Sample size: 100mm (W) x 100mm (D) x 10mm (H), max. Weight: 300 grams
Stage movement: Z-axis 10.5mm by manual knob rotation
Droplet dispensing: Manual dispenser with rotation knob
Droplet deposition: By stage up/down movement
Measuring temperature: Ambient
Power requirements: USB bus power. DC5V, 2W max
Dimensions, weight: 170 mm (W) x 346 mm (D) x 283 mm (H), approx. 2.6 kg
Operating environment:
Temperature: 10 - 35°C, Relative humidity: 30 - 80%
Applications:
The contact angle meter has application in the pharma field, where the wettability of powders can be studied. The contact angle measurement gives remarkable data on wettability and thus pharma companies can use this tool in their analytical research and development. It can also be used to analyze the processes of coating, cleaning, and surface finishing in research institutes
